A communication flow is carried over one of four transfer types defined by the USB device.
Each transfer results in one or more transactions over the USB bus. There are three kinds of
transactions flowing across the bus in packets:
1. Setup Transaction
2. Data IN Transaction
3. Data OUT Transaction
